What is Paper Trading?

Paper trading, also known as simulated trading or virtual trading, involves placing orders in a live market using demo accounts provided by brokers. This allows traders to practice strategies, analyze market trends, and assess their risk management skills without the fear of incurring real financial losses. The trades made through these accounts do not affect the investor's actual portfolio; they are purely hypothetical and are used for learning and strategy testing purposes.

Benefits of Paper Trading for Indian Stocks

1. Learning and Skill Building: Through paper trading, beginners can learn about stock market operations without risking real money. This hands-on experience helps in understanding market dynamics, making decisions, and analyzing trends more comprehensively.

2. Risk Management: One of the key advantages of paper trading is that it provides a safe environment to experiment with different strategies and risk management techniques. Traders can assess how they handle losses or gains without affecting their real portfolio.

3. Psychological Adaptation: The Indian stock market, like any other, carries its share of volatility and stress-inducing situations. Paper trading allows investors to psychologically adapt to these conditions before investing real money. It helps in building confidence and resilience through simulated experiences.

4. Innovative Strategy Testing: Investors can test new strategies or trade setups that they are not entirely confident about on paper without the pressure of loss. This flexibility is crucial for innovation and adaptation in trading practices.

How to Use Paper Trading Effectively for Indian Stocks?

1. Understand Market Dynamics: Before diving into paper trading, it's essential to have a solid understanding of the Indian stock market. This includes knowledge about different sectors, market indices, and regulatory frameworks.

2. Choose a Reliable Broker: Selecting a reputable broker that offers quality demo accounts with real-time data is crucial for effective paper trading. It should also offer tools like charting software, news feeds, and research materials to enhance the learning experience.

3. Develop Trading Strategies: Start by developing your strategies based on technical analysis, fundamental analysis, or a combination of both. Paper trading provides an ideal environment to test these strategies under various market conditions.

4. Set Realistic Goals: Clearly define your paper trading goals. Whether it's learning new techniques, testing specific strategies, or just gaining experience, having clear objectives helps in managing expectations and focusing efforts.

5. Practice Discipline: Just like real trading, the key to successful paper trading lies in discipline. This includes setting stop-loss limits, not over-trading, and avoiding high-risk actions. Paper losses are no consolation for real losses; hence, discipline is paramount.
